Threads can unlock a "private" Instagram account đź‘€
Many people assume that making their Instagram profile private also limits what others can learn about them. In reality, Threads can expose valuable OSINT breadcrumbs.
Because Threads accounts are directly linked to Instagram, they share the same username. That connection alone can help confirm that two profiles belong to the same person—even if one of them has since changed its username.
The bigger issue is privacy settings. When Threads launched, many users left their Threads profiles public without realizing those settings were independent of Instagram. As a result, a private Instagram account may still have a public Threads profile revealing:
• Posts, replies, and likes
• Followers and following lists
• Bio details that aren't present on Instagram
• Searchable public content through Threads' full-text search
Even interactions with other public accounts can help map relationships, interests, and communities.
In OSINT, investigations rarely start with a complete picture. They start with a single breadcrumb—a username, a bio, or a public interaction—and each clue helps build the next.
Privacy is rarely defined by a single platform. It's shaped by the connections between them.
